Software Application Licensing: Perpetual vs Subscription

Software Application Licensing: Perpetual vs Subscription

The Evolution of Software Licensing: From Standalone to Connected

The software licensing landscape has undergone a dramatic transformation since the early days of computing. What was once a simple transaction of purchasing a product with a one-time license key has evolved into a complex ecosystem of flexible, interconnected licensing models.

Historical Context: The Standalone Software Era

In the nascent stages of personal computing, software applications were predominantly standalone products. These applications operated in isolation, with minimal network connectivity and limited update mechanisms. Users would purchase a physical copy or download software, activate it with a license key, and use it indefinitely.

The traditional perpetual licensing model was straightforward:

  • One-time purchase
  • Permanent software ownership
  • Limited or no automatic updates
  • Potential additional costs for version upgrades

Understanding Perpetual Licensing: The Traditional Approach

Perpetual licensing represents the classic software ownership model. When you purchase a perpetual license, you acquire the right to use a specific version of software indefinitely. This model has several distinct characteristics:

Pros of Perpetual Licensing

  • Predictable Cost Structure: A single upfront investment covers your software usage
  • Long-term Ownership: No recurring monthly or annual fees
  • Budget Stability: Easier financial planning for organizations
  • No Dependency on Continuous Internet Connectivity

Cons of Perpetual Licensing

  • Limited Update Access: Typically requires additional payment for major version upgrades
  • Potential Obsolescence: Software can quickly become outdated
  • Higher Initial Investment
  • Maintenance and Support Often Come at Extra Cost

The Rise of Subscription Licensing: A Modern Paradigm

Subscription licensing has emerged as a dynamic alternative to the traditional perpetual model. This approach provides continuous access to software with regular updates, cloud integration, and flexible scaling options.

Advantages of Subscription Licensing

  • Continuous Updates: Always access the latest features and security patches
  • Lower Initial Investment
  • Scalable and Flexible
  • Integrated Cloud Services
  • Predictable Recurring Expenses

Potential Drawbacks

  • Ongoing Financial Commitment
  • Potential Higher Long-term Costs
  • Dependency on Service Provider
  • Potential Service Discontinuation Risks

Market Trends: Why Subscription is Gaining Momentum

Several industry factors are driving the shift towards subscription-based models:

  1. Cloud Computing Integration: Seamless updates and synchronization
  2. Reduced Piracy Risks: More robust licensing mechanisms
  3. Continuous Innovation: Faster feature rollout
  4. Lower Entry Barriers: Reduced upfront costs

Choosing Between Perpetual and Subscription: Key Considerations

For Individual Users

  • Budget Constraints
  • Software Usage Frequency
  • Update Requirements
  • Long-term Professional Needs

For Enterprises

  • Total Cost of Ownership
  • Scalability Requirements
  • IT Infrastructure
  • Compliance and Security Needs

The Hybrid Approach: Emerging Licensing Models

Some software providers are introducing hybrid models that combine elements of perpetual and subscription licensing, offering greater flexibility and choice.

Future Outlook: Licensing in the Digital Age

The software licensing landscape continues to evolve, driven by:

  • Advanced cloud technologies
  • Enhanced cybersecurity measures
  • Changing consumer and enterprise expectations
  • Rapid technological innovation

Conclusion: Making an Informed Decision

Selecting between perpetual and subscription licensing isn’t about finding a universal solution, but understanding your specific needs. Carefully evaluate your requirements, budget, and long-term objectives.

Key Takeaway: The right licensing model is the one that aligns perfectly with your operational strategy and financial framework.

Recommendations

  • Conduct a comprehensive cost-benefit analysis
  • Consider future scalability
  • Evaluate vendor reputation and support
  • Prioritize flexibility and innovation potential

About the Author: A seasoned software licensing expert with decades of experience navigating the complex world of software acquisition and management.

Share this article
Scroll to Top